Ejemplo n.º 1
0
        /// <summary>
        /// 设置登录信息
        /// </summary>
        /// <param name="model"></param>
        public static void SetLoginInfo(Model.GSPUser data)
        {
            var jwt = JsonWebToken.Encode(data, "XB#4%", JwtHashAlgorithm.RS256);

            CookieHelper.WriteCookie("EAToken", jwt);
        }
Ejemplo n.º 2
0
 /// <summary>
 ///  清空用户信息
 /// </summary>
 public static void EmptyUser()
 {
     model = null;
 }
Ejemplo n.º 3
0
        public DynamicParameters GetParamsRef(List <string> keys, DataRow row, Model.EACmpCategory model, Model.GSPUser user)
        {
            DynamicParameters p = new DynamicParameters();
            var arr             = new List <object>();

            p.Add("0", Guid.NewGuid().ToString());
            p.Add("1", user.Id);
            p.Add("2", user.Name);
            p.Add("3", DateTime.Now.ToString("yyyy-MM-dd HH:mm:ss"));
            p.Add("4", model.DWBH);
            p.Add("5", model.ID);
            p.Add("6", "0");
            int i = 7;

            foreach (string key in keys)
            {
                p.Add(i.ToString(), row[key].ToString());
                i++;
            }

            return(p);
        }
Ejemplo n.º 4
0
 /// <summary>
 /// 设置登录信息
 /// </summary>
 /// <param name="model"></param>
 public static void SetLoginInfo(Model.GSPUser data)
 {
     model = data;
 }